New Initiative to Enhance Education for Children Amidst Conflict

Every child deserves access to quality education, regardless of their circumstances. Due to conflict, forced displacement, or disruptions in learning, many students have lost the ability to fully grasp important knowledge.

By helping them catch up, educators not only boost their confidence and motivation but also aid in better socialization—restoring connections with peers and ensuring a sense of safety.

In June, diagnostic assessments are conducted in educational institutions owned by the community in Odesa to identify educational losses among students. Additional classes, consultations, and group work are provided to facilitate better material comprehension.

To address educational losses for younger students, a program called «KETCH» has been developed by the NGO «Go Global». This initiative aims to support younger school children who have lost part of their knowledge due to the ongoing conflict, providing schools with effective tools for adaptive and intensive learning.

The project is being implemented with the support of UNICEF in Ukraine, Global Partnership for Education (GPE), and the Animagrad studio (FILM.UA Group).
